Handover for tonight: the user module is split out of the Bramblecore monolith as of this deploy. Auth still proxies through the monolith; profile reads hit the new service directly. If the new service dies, flip the fallback flag — reads degrade, writes queue. Dashboards are under "Usersplit." The service starts with the config below.

config for tagep-yajef:
ulawyn:
  log_level: error
  metrics_host: metrics.ulawyn.lumiclabs.internal
  pin: 0564
  pool_size: 32

## Step 4: Cut over from LegacyQueue

Velmora's homegrown job queue is gone. Workers now pull from Drayline's broker. Remove `queue_poll.py` from the cron manifest before deploying — leaving it causes double-processing.

Verify the broker is reachable from the worker subnet, then drain in-flight jobs with `drayctl drain --wait`. Deploy the new worker image. Jobs enqueued during cutover are buffered by the shim for up to five minutes.

Authentication uses a broker token in `.env.production`. Add the following line directly below this sentence.

vault entry, yahif-yajep: COURIER_KEY29=b802bdf8034096b65a51c6ba5abe2

## Veltrow Catalog — Environments

Cache invalidation on the Veltrow product catalog runs through the Pikefield purge queue. When support sees stale prices, the usual cause is a stuck purge consumer in staging, not prod. Check the consumer lag dashboard before escalating. Each environment's cache tier is configured with the following values.

config for tahag-yajop:
silok:
  pin: 9177
  tenant: kelius
  seal: seal_2648020a
  metrics_host: metrics.silok.lumicsys.internal
  standby_team: beldor
  escalation: kelys-druys
  nonce: 55d17c